天天看點

html5 mobile angular ui,angular用什麼ui架構?

AngularJS是為了克服HTML在建構應用上的不足而設計的。HTML是一門很好的為靜态文本展示設計的聲明式語言,但要建構WEB應用的話它就顯得乏力了。

html5 mobile angular ui,angular用什麼ui架構?

下面我們來看一下angular使用的UI架構有哪些?

PrimeNG

PrimeNG是Angular的豐富UI元件的集合。所有小部件都是開源的,可以根據MIT許可證免費使用。PrimeNG由PrimeTek Informatics開發,PrimeTek Informatics是一家在開發開源UI解決方案方面擁有多年專業知識的供應商。

Angular UI Bootstrap

從名字你就可以知道,Angular UI Bootstrap使用頂級架構——Bootstrap建構。你可以使用此架構來重寫現有的JavaScript代碼,并建立新的代碼。Angular UI Bootstrap能幫助你拿出比原來的JavaScript代碼更小的指令。

更小的版本,更容易內建到AngularJS生态系統或環境中。

Angular Foundation

Angular Foundation是一個流行的完全相容AngularJS指令和其他自定義HTML元素的架構。采用Angular Foundation,你可以建立帶有更精确HTML元素,如頁碼和頂欄的web應用程式。

Ionic

你是否需要一個可以讓開發本地移動應用程式變得容易的架構?Ionic——一個有影響力的HTML5原生應用程式開發架構,就是你可以get最好的架構。

Mobile Angular UI

Mobile Angular UI是一個類似jQuery Mobile的移動UI架構。一些Bootstrap 3沒有的重要的元件,如可滾動區域、工具條和開關,Mobile Angular UI中都有。Mobile Angular UI也支援頂部和底部的導航欄在滾動時不跳動。

Mobile Angular UI可增強移動體驗,因為它的元素來源于可靠的庫管道,如fastclick.js和overthrow.js。Mobile Angular UI的文法在很大程度上類似于Bootstrap3。

是以,它并不完全适合于移動目前的桌面網站應用程式到移動端。相反,它有一個超小的CSS檔案可以移動移動網站應用程式到桌面。使用那個檔案,你會得到一個完全的響應接口。

Supersonic

Supersonic UI是一個值得關注的架構,它能夠提升你的混合app體驗到一個新的水準。Supersonic有一個聲明式的UI功能,能夠使得建構移動應用程式的過程像吃棉花糖一樣簡單。

Suave-UI

得益于它提供的各種CSS定義,指令和托管服務,該架構可幫助你輕松高效地建立UI。

UI Grid

UI Grid适合那些想要實作複雜功能的開發人員。使用UI Grid,你還可以執行列排序和列篩選。UI Grid允許你在一個地方編輯資料,并提供非常多的功能。